I bought this gigantic beautiful Brahma roo at our state fair this past fall. He was so huge I just had to have him. Brought him home and noticed that he had a funny gait to his walk, sort of like he was stomping his feet with each step. He stayed the same for several months. A few weeks later I noticed that his toenails were loose and falling off, and that his feet look a little swollen. And within the last week it looks like his feet are decaying....they have black tips on the toes and skin looks like it is starting to slough off. He has lost a lot of weight also.
I have tried to research it on the internet, but cant seem to find the answer....
It must not be contagious, as he has been with my hens for 4-5 months and they havent shown any signs at all.

I am devastated....I have gave him different types of antibiotics and vitamins hoping it would help, but nothing is working. I really hate to lose this boy, he is friendly and handsome, plus this breed is pretty hard to find in my area.
